Alterations in neuroendocrine and immune function were examined in sedentary (n=15) (VO2peak; 31.4+/-0.7 ml x kg(-1) x min(-1); 24.4+/-1.2yr), moderately active (n=15) (VO2peak; 45.4+/-1.1 ml x kg(-1) x min(-1); 24.2+/-1.1 yr) and aerobically trained (n=15) (VO2peak; 58.8+/-0.9 ml x kg(-1) x min(-1); 24.3+/-1.0 yr) men following exposure to an acute mild psychological stressor. Subjects had 2 min to prepare, and 3 min to deliver a speech in front of 3 observers. Blood samples were drawn from an indwelling catheter before, during and 30 min following the speech task (ST). Self-reported measures of anxiety were obtained prior to and immediately following the stressor. The ST resulted in significant alterations in the number and function of immune cells, and in self-reported anxiety scores. Plasma levels of norepinephrine increased during the speech task. The neuroendocrine and immune response to the chosen stressor were independent of subject aerobic fitness level.

A specific programme elaborated for microcalculator "Electronika MK 61" can be applied by intensive care specialists to mathematical processing of the results of impedance plethysmography and phase analysis of the cardiac cycle.
